For nearly two decades, Photodex ProShow Producer stood as the industry standard for professional slideshow creation. Photographers, videographers, and multimedia enthusiasts relied on its robust architecture to turn still images into dynamic cinematic experiences. Version 9.0.3797 marked one of the final stable releases of this iconic software before Photodex officially closed its doors in 2020. Photodex Proshow Producer 9.0.3797 Registration Key

: Photodex ceased all operations and shut down its official website and support on January 31, 2020 .
Websites promising a "working key generator," "crack," or "patched executable" for version 9.0.3797 typically deliver hidden malware, trojans, or ransomware. These files compromise your operating system and steal personal data. , which was developed by the same core
: Searching for "Registration Keys" or "Serial Keys" for this software often leads to high-risk websites. Version 9.0.3797 is also known to have a local privilege escalation vulnerability (CVE-2019-12788), making it a security risk to run on modern systems. Potential Recovery for Existing Owners
ProShow requires an internet handshake with Photodex servers to clear its trial limitations. Because those servers no longer exist, typing in a alphanumeric string—whether bought legally in 2018 or sourced from a sketchy web forum—will result in an error or a persistent "illegal use" evaluation banner.

Even if a user manages to bypass the activation screen using a legacy key, running ProShow Producer 9.0.3797 on modern operating systems introduces stability issues. The software was built for older architecture. On Windows 10 and Windows 11, users frequently report random crashes during heavy rendering, audio desynchronization, and compatibility errors with newer graphics card drivers.
